Starquids Posted August 29, 2019 Report Share Posted August 29, 2019 At £29 per replacement arm, let’s make them new for a tenner. Primer & satin black aerosol & wire wool, £10 from Wilko. Cheap! Flat wipers £5.70 PAIR from Amazon. (21”& 19” ) free delivery if you’re in no hurry. Bargain! 1. Open bonnet. Lever cap off nut using small flat blade screwdriver. 2. Unbolt nuts with 13mm ring spanner or small socket set. 3. Lift off arms from spindles. Do not twist as you’ll damage splines. 4. Rub down arms with wire wool. Spray grey primer lightly, 2 coats. Spray 2 light coats satin black. Always wait 15 mins between coats to allow to dry. Now leave for 24 hours to fully harden. 5. Replace wiper blades now if needed, then refit, reverse of removal.
